Kate:
I am glad it's over, the TT part. It was in large part to the information and help I found here that also helped prepare me for what to expect before, during and after. Biggest piece of advice I can give you, is to allow yourself time to heal. I thought I'd be all gunho and back to work in a couple of days - NOT. At least not for me. Today, was the first day since the surgery that I actually slept, and I mean I slept all day. I needed it. Also, drink lots of fluids, to keep yourself hydrate and your colon happy, nothing says OUCH worse than constipation which comes with the territory of being hypo after surgery.
